题目 给定一个01数组 arr 和 一个整数 k, 统计有多少区间符合如下条件: 区间的两个端点都为 0 (允许区间长度为1) 区间内 1 的个数不多于 k arr 的大小不超过 10^5 样例 1:...解题 使用队列记录队列内的 和 s, 维护 s <= k class Solution { public: /** * @param arr: the 01 array *
IMDG的特性 IMDG产品之一HazelCast的功能列表如下。由于HazelCast持有双重许可证政策,你必须购买商业许可证才能使用某些功能,例如ElasticMemory(弹性内存)。...尽管很难说HazelCast的功能是所有其他IMDG产品提供的功能,但我决定在这里介绍它,因为我认为HazelCast是了解IMDG功能的一个很好的例子。...分布式集合 你可以使用DistributedSet(分布式集合),DistributedList(分布式列表)或DistributedQueue(分布式队列)。...分布式主题(Topic)和分布式事件 HazelCast提供了主题阅读的功能,以保证发布消息的顺序。这意味着你可以将其用作分布式消息队列系统。...在这种情况下,你将能够通过使用RDBMS作为后端系统来响应统计处理。这意味着RDBMS在互联网服务中的角色可以成为辅助。
Hazelcast是一款由Hazelcast开发的基于jvm环境的为各种应用提供分布式集群服务的分布式缓存解决方案。可以嵌入到java、c++、.net等开发的产品中使用。...其主要功能有: 提供了 Map、Queue、MultiMap、Set、List、Semaphore、Atomic 等接口的分布式实现; 提供了基于Topic 实现的消息队列或订阅\发布模式; 提供了分布式...-- https://mvnrepository.com/artifact/com.hazelcast/hazelcast-all --> ...这个文件非常重要,如果没有,那么hazelcast将无法使用。...hazelcast: network: join: multicast: enabled: true 只需要加上上述配置,hazelcast就能使用了。
Tapdata Cloud 是国内首家异构数据库实时同步云平台,目前支持Oracle、MySQL、PG、SQL Server、MongoDB、ES 、达梦、Kafka、GP、MQ、ClickHouse、Hazelcast...>>> 上新数据源: TiDB,Dummy DB 关系型数据库,NoSQL,NewSQL,消息队列,云上云下,自由流转 1.0.9 版本新增 TiDB 作为同步目标,并支持 Dummy DB 作为数据源...多维度统计,更直观了解任务进度 1.0.9 版本对数据库同步任务详情进行了优化,用户可以看到同步的进度,同步进程一目了然。
Redis 终究也没想到在开源界也可以有跨界杀手.Hazelcast VS Redis 的性能测结果:原文地址:https://hazelcast.com/resources/benchmark-redis-vs-hazelcast...分布式缓存能力是 Hazelcast 的一个基础原子能力, 在诸多真实的项目中选择引入 Hazelcast 有各种各样的使用场景和选型需求,大概率是基于 Hazelcast 丰富的原子能力和业务场景适用性...,更多的使用场景.Hazelcast 在官网的介绍也凸显出 Hazelcast 的能力和使用场景的多样性.先了解下 Hazelcast 的整体架构.可以从官方公布的体系架构中看到 Hazelcast 的整体结构和基础模块和原子能力....综合官网的介绍 Hazelcast 的功能点和原子能力包含:基于 Topic 实现的消息队列或订阅\发布模式;分布式 java.util....Blog ,官方开发人员和社区开发者都会分享一些 Hazelcast 最新动态和基于 Hazelcast 最新的 Idea 和 Solution!
match-engine 介绍 match-trade超高效的交易所撮合引擎,采用伦敦外汇交易所LMAX开源的Disruptor框架,用Hazelcast进行分布式内存存取,以及原子性操作。...优势 match-engine水平价格为独立撮合逻辑,相比于订单队列为撮合队列的交易引擎来说,价格区间越小时,性能越优越。...Hazelcast: 很好进行内存处理,很强原子性保障的操作能力。同时分布式内存实现很简单,能自动内存集群。据说火币也在用。...hzInstance.getMap(HzltUtil.getMatchKey(coinTeam, isBuy)); if (map.size() > 0) { /** * -这个流:主要是安价格分组和统计
Hazelcast 是由Hazelcast公司(没错,这公司也叫Hazelcast!)开发和维护的开源产品,可以为基于jvm环境运行的各种应用提供分布式集群和分布式缓存服务。...Hazelcast 提供了 Map、Queue、MultiMap、Set、List、Semaphore、Atomic 等接口的分布式实现;提供了基于Topic 实现的消息队列或订阅\发布模式;提供了分布式...附: Hazelcast源码:https://github.com/hazelcast/hazelcast 关于Hazelcast的问题可以到https://github.com/hazelcast/hazelcast...Hazelcast的特性 自治集群(无中心化) Hazelcast 没有任何中心节点(文中的节点可以理解为运行在任意服务器的独立jvm,下同),或者说Hazelcast 不需要特别指定一个中心节点。...:hazelcast:${hazelcast.vertsion} 先创一个建 Hazelcast 节点: //org.palm.hazelcast.getstart.HazelcastGetStartServerMaster
但是,Hazelcast有个致命的问题,它还很不成熟,在版本升级中可能会不兼容。比如在ONOS1.1.0中依然有很多Hazelcast相关的Bug,这就意味着ONOS依赖于一个不成熟的库,风险会很大。...有人会觉得,不管怎样Hazelcast会不断改进的,如果有问题直接提交Bug给Hazelcast不就解决了?或者说咱们也是做开源的,帮Hazelcast改进为什么不行?...原因是当ONOS有了Hazelcast的Bug后就成了ONOS的Bug,解决这样的Bug一方面是存在时间上的风险,另外一方面也取决于Hazelcast是否会因为支持ONOS而进行升级。...上篇文章也提到过Intent需要强一致性来保障,Intent数据是通过分布式队列发送,因此也需要支持基于Raft的数据库服务。 ?...官方网站:http://hazelcast.org/ Hadelcast架构介绍文档:http://docs.hazelcast.org/docs/latest/manual/html/overview.html
Tapdata Cloud 是国内首家异构数据库实时同步云平台,目前支持Oracle、MySQL、PG、SQL Server、MongoDB、ES 、达梦、Kafka、GP、MQ、ClickHouse、Hazelcast...>>> 上新ClickHouse等5个数据源 ClickHouse | Hazelcast Cloud | ADB MySQL | ADB PostgreSQL | KunDB 关系型数据库,NoSQL...,NewSQL,消息队列,云上云下,自由流转 <<< 不断优化,提供更佳体验 对于用户使用的各个环节,我们一直在努力提供更佳体验 Tapdata Cloud 支持多种部署环境,包括:Linux,Windows
图片订单管理中心订单管理中心是整个物流架构中的核心组成部分,它负责接收、处理和管理所有的订单信息。...订单管理中心可以实现订单的自动化处理和跟踪,包括订单生成、订单审核、订单分配、订单配送、订单结算等流程。此外,订单管理中心还可以提供订货人、收货人、发货人等相关信息的管理和查询功能。...此外,物流资源交易中心还可以提供资源查询、资源统计等功能。主数据管理中心主数据管理中心是负责管理整个物流过程中的核心数据,包括物流节点、物流路线、物流产品、物流价格等各方面的数据。...主数据管理中心可以实现数据的自动化管理和控制,包括数据的录入、数据的审核、数据的发布等功能。此外,主数据管理中心还可以提供数据查询、数据统计等功能。...此外,溯源管理平台还可以提供产品追溯信息的统计和分析等功能。
作业一:食堂就餐卡系统设计 系统中每个消费者都有一张卡,在管理中心注册缴费,卡内记着消费者的身份、余额。...管理中心的管理员监视每一笔消费,可打印出消费情况的相关统计数据。 请设计系统用例图,组件图,组件时序图,部署图。...通过脑图,梳理整体设计: 1.1 功能概述 系统功能包括:管理中心开卡注册、缴费、统计消费情况、收款机刷卡消费。 使用者包括:管理中心后台管理员、收款机(消费者、收银员操作时的实体对象)。...2.1 系统用例图 管理中心后台管理员:通过读卡器读取卡信息(在卡面ID不可修改的前提下,不依赖读卡器也行),通过与卡管理系统交互进行开卡操作,通过与交易系统交互完成缴费操作,通过与统计系统交互完成数据统计操作...2.6 统计场景时序图 管理中心通过统计系统,调用交易系统获取交易数据,并根据需要的维度进行聚合展示。
4.5 修改hazelcast.xml文件 配置TCP / IP模式机制,并添加对应节点信息,修改后主要配置信息如下: clusterName... ...ORIENTDB_HOME}/config/default-distributed-db-config.json" na$ <parameter value="${ORIENTDB_HOME}/config/<em>hazelcast</em>.xml...如果启用,则当节点脱机时,同步消息将保留在分布式<em>队列</em>中。当它回到在线时,通过轮询<em>队列</em>中的所有同步消息来启动同步阶段。 servers :用于指定集群中节点的角色(主节点或副本节点)。
内存框架选择:开始考虑的是redis,最终决定用Hazelcast主要原因是简单,快,集群方便。 ...hzInstance.getMap(HzltUtil.getMatchKey(coinTeam, isBuy)); if (map.size() > 0) { /** * -这个流:主要是安价格分组和统计...问题三:我看过有的朋友把买卖盘分成2个撮合队列,那么同时来买卖市价,是两个以上次成交价对吃吗,还是各自吃对手盘呢?
使用消息队列」 更新操作写入消息队列,然后由消息队列保证最终一致性。 消费者从队列中读取更新消息,并按照消息顺序更新数据库和缓存。 「4....使用缓存框架的一致性支持」 使用像Hazelcast、Apache Ignite这样的分布式缓存解决方案,它们提供了一些内置的数据一致性保证机制。
支持 Hazelcast Hazelcast 和 Redis 一样,它是一款开源的分布式内存数据库,可用作分布式缓存。...Hazelcast 自动配置嵌入式服务器现在默认使用了 SpringManagerContext,可以在 Hazelcast 实例对象中注入 Spring Bean 了。...另外,还引入了HazelcastConfigCustomizer 回调接口,可用于进一步调整 Hazelcast 服务器配置。...欢迎来投票统计看下! 好了,今天的分享就到这里了,后面栈长会分享更多好玩的 Java 技术和最新的技术资讯,关注公众号Java技术栈第一时间推送。
spring.task.execution.pool.queue-capacity=100 spring.task.execution.pool.keep-alive=10s 这会将线程池更改为使用有界队列...,以便在队列满(100个任务)时,线程池增加到最多16个线程。...如果 spring-integration-jmx 也在类路径上,则通过JMX发布消 息处理统计信息。...构建Servlet Web应用程序时,可以自动配置以下存储: JDBC Redis Hazelcast MongoDB的 构建响应式Web应用程序时,可以自动配置以下存储: Redis MongoDB的
} } FailureDetector的构造器接收三个参数,分别是minimumSamples, windowSize, distribution 其中minimumSamples表示最少需要多少统计值的时候才真正计算...phi值,windowSize表示统计窗口的大小,distribution表示使用哪种分布,normal表示NormalDistribution,其他表示ExponentialDistribution...FailureDetector使用了apache commons math的DescriptiveStatistics来作为Heartbeat Interval的时间窗口统计;使用了NormalDistribution...ExponentialDistribution两种实现方式 doc The Phi Accrual Failure Detector by Hayashibara et al PhiAccrualFailureDetector.scala 聊聊hazelcast
基于资产管理中心提供的资产目录与分类分级结果,自动生成分类分级明细清单、统计分类分级完成度、并结合分类分级有效期、分类分级管理制度等指标进行合理评价。 数据资产风险 。...基于风险管理中心提供的安全告警,结合数据资产分类分级情况,对不同类别、不同级别的数据资产的不同风险形成明细清单与统计图表,结合数据处理活动、联防联控措施等指标进行合理评价。 数据权限管理 。...基于风险管理中心提供的多源行为日志库,按操作时间等不同维度自动生成数据操作审计明细表与操作热度统计表,结合分类分级结果和数据处理活动进行合理评价。 应急响应 。...基于风险管理中心提供的风险告警与事件处置数据,自动生成告警-事件-处置明细表,按分类分级、响应时长等不同维度生成统计图表,结合数据处理活动进行合理评价。...,通过对安全策略变更和数据库、应用、API等涉敏对象的敏感数据量、敏感数据类型等指标进行统计分析与趋势预测,自动生成敏感数据流动态势图;基于风险管理中心提供的数据,对分布在不同位置、不同时间、不同类别、
本地DDos防护设备一般分为DDos检测设备、清洗设备和管理中心。...首先,DDos检测设备日常通过流量基线自学习方式,按各种和防御有关的维度,比如syn报文速率、http访问速率等进行统计,形成流量模型基线,从而生成防御阈值。...学习结束后继续按基线学习的维度做流量统计,并将每一秒钟的统计结果和防御阈值进行比较,超过则认为有异常,通告管理中心。由管理中心下发引流策略到清洗设备,启动引流清洗。
领取专属 10元无门槛券
手把手带您无忧上云